Body
Origins and Family
Alexander Kuznetsov's place of birth was Moscow[2]. He was born on November 1, 1973[3].
Education
Educated at MSU Faculty of Mechanics and Mathematics[10], a faculty[27], in Soviet Union[28], founded in 1933[29]; Lomonosov Moscow State University[11], a public university[30], in Russia[31], founded in 1755[32], headquartered in Moscow[33]; and Moscow State School 57[12], a public school[34], in Soviet Union[35], founded in 1877[36]. Doctoral advisors include Alexey Bondal[13], a mathematician[37], b. 2000[38], of Russia[39] and Alexei Kostrikin[14], a mathematician[40], 1929–2000[41], of Soviet Union[42], awarded the USSR State Prize[43], specialised in algebra[44]. Alexander Kuznetsov earned the academic degree of Doctor of Sciences in Physics and Mathematics[20].
Career and Affiliations
Alexander Kuznetsov's professions included mathematician[4]. His field of work was algebraic geometry[7]. Employers include National Research University – Higher School of Economics[8], a national research university[45], in Russia[46], founded in 1992[47], headquartered in Moscow[48] and Steklov Institute of Mathematics[9], a research institute[49], in Russia[50], founded in 1934[51]. He supervised Anton Fonarev as a doctoral student[19].
Recognition
Awards received include Russian President’s Prize for Young Scientists[15], a state decoration[52], in Russia[53], founded in 2008[54] and EMS Prize[16], a science award[55], founded in 1992[56].
